检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
概述 欢迎使用Koosearch服务。Koosearch服务为您提供托管的分布式搜索引擎服务+大模型生成能力。本文档提供了Koosearch服务API的描述、语法、参数说明及样例等内容。 父主题: 使用前必读
知识库管理 创建知识库 修改知识库配置 设置知识库搜索问答prompt 设置知识库通用无搜索的prompt 开启知识库 关闭知识库 获取知识库列表 查看知识库列表 删除知识库
FAQ管理 创建FAQ 更新FAQ 获取FAQ 查询FAQ列表 删除FAQ 批量删除FAQ
新增模型 功能介绍 新增配置模型,包括模型名称、模型描述、模型endpoint、模型配置。 URI POST /v1/koosearch/models 请求参数 表1 请求Header参数 参数 是否必选 参数类型 描述 X-Auth-Token 是 String 接口鉴权使用的
结构化数据 上传结构化数据 下载失败的条目 搜索结构化数据文件
图片管理 上传图片 获取图片内容
创建FAQ 功能介绍 输入问题、相似问题、答案,创建单条FAQ。 URI POST /v1/koosearch/repos/{repo_id}/faqs 表1 路径参数 参数 是否必选 参数类型 描述 repo_id 是 String 知识库ID,1~64个字符,只能包含数字、字母、中划线和下划线。
删除FAQ 功能介绍 根据知识库ID和FAQ的ID,删除FAQ。 URI DELETE /v1/koosearch/repos/{repo_id}/faqs/{faq_id} 表1 路径参数 参数 是否必选 参数类型 描述 faq_id 是 String FAQ编号 最小长度:1
获取FAQ 功能介绍 根据ID获取FAQ详情,包括问题、答案。 URI GET /v1/koosearch/repos/{repo_id}/faqs/{faq_id} 表1 路径参数 参数 是否必选 参数类型 描述 faq_id 是 String FAQ ID,1~64个字符,只
FAQ批量管理 批量FAQ上传 列举批量上传FAQ文件 下载上传失败的FAQ 下载批量导入FAQ原文件 删除批量导入FAQ文件
删除对话历史 功能介绍 根据指定ID,删除对应的对话历史。 URI DELETE /v1/koosearch/chat-history/{chat_history_id} 表1 路径参数 参数 是否必选 参数类型 描述 chat_history_id 是 String 对话历史ID
删除文档接口 功能介绍 删除指定ID的文件。 URI DELETE /v1/koosearch/repos/{repo_id}/files/{file_id} 表1 路径参数 参数 是否必选 参数类型 描述 repo_id 是 String 知识库ID,1~64个字符,只能包含数字、字母、中划线和下划线。
错误码 当您调用API时,如果遇到“APIGW”开头的错误码,请参见API网关错误码进行处理。 状态码 错误码 错误信息 描述 处理措施 400 KOS.00010001 JSON格式异常 JSON格式异常。 根据具体提示信息修改参数。 400 KOS.00010002 请求参数不合法
生成答案 功能介绍 将content输入给模型,使用模型能力生成答案。 注意: 当"chat_id"为空时,"chat_create_flag"应为"1",表示需要开启新的对话;当"chat_id"有值时,"chat_create_flag"可以为"0",表示不需要开启新的对话。
更新FAQ 功能介绍 更新指定ID的FAQ的问题、答案、相似问题。 URI PUT /v1/koosearch/repos/{repo_id}/faqs 表1 路径参数 参数 是否必选 参数类型 描述 repo_id 是 String 知识库ID,1~64个字符,只能包含数字、字母、中划线和下划线。
修改模型配置 功能介绍 修改模型配置 URI PUT /v1/koosearch/models/{model_name} 表1 路径参数 参数 是否必选 参数类型 描述 model_name 是 String 模型名称 最小长度:1 最大长度:64 请求参数 表2 请求Header参数
调用说明 KooSearch服务提供了REST(Representational State Transfer)风格API,支持您通过HTTPS请求调用,调用方法请参见如何调用API。 父主题: 使用前必读
返回结果 状态码 请求发送以后,您会收到响应,包含状态码、响应消息头和消息体。 状态码是一组从1xx到5xx的数字代码,状态码表示了请求响应的状态,完整的状态码列表请参见状态码。 对于获取用户Token接口,如果调用后返回状态码为“201”,则表示请求成功。 响应消息头 对应请求
批量FAQ上传 功能介绍 上传xlsx/xls文件,用于FAQ的批量导入。 URI POST /v1/koosearch/repos/{repo_id}/faqs/files 表1 路径参数 参数 是否必选 参数类型 描述 repo_id 是 String 知识库ID,1~64个
基本概念 账号 用户注册时的账号,账号对其所拥有的资源及云服务具有完全的访问权限,可以重置用户密码、分配用户权限等。由于账号是付费主体,为了确保账号安全,建议您不要直接使用账号进行日常管理工作,而是创建用户并使用他们进行日常管理工作 用户 由账号在IAM中创建的用户,是云服务的使